After a decade of tapering down its military presence in the region, USA is back with a huge display of force. In the past few days two fighter squadrons have flown in. They follow the deployment of two aircraft-carrier strike groups, multiple air-defence systems and much aid to Israel. More units have been told to prepare to deploy.
America’s goal is to deter attacks on American interests, on Israel and to a degree on its Arab allies.
But what if deterrence fails? Could USA be dragged back into another Middle East war?

The expert stated that, The US plans to increase its military presence in the Middle East region again by 2024 amid the ongoing fighting:
" Under the instructions of President Biden on recent escalations and provocations led by Iran and its proxy forces across the Middle East Region, the Pentagon has directed a series of additional steps to further strengthen the Department of Defense posture in the region. According to Secretary of Defense Lloyd Austin: “These steps will bolster regional deterrence efforts, increase force protection for U.S. forces in the region, and assist in the defense of Israel.
”Austin also said that he redirected the USS Dwight D. Eisenhower Strike Group to join the USS Gerald R. Ford Carrier Strike Group, which is currently stationed in the Eastern Mediterranean Sea. He said this move with “further increase our force posture and strengthen our capabilities and ability to respond to a range of contingences.”
